When can I expect good weather in Managua?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Managua rel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ually April and March with an average temp of 83°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 79°F. The rainiest months in Managua are October, June, September, and August, with each month seeing an average of 11 inches of rainfall.
What's there to see and do in Managua?
Take in the sights and attractions that Managua offers with a visit to Plaza Inter, Tiscapa Lagoon, and Alexis Argüello Sports Complex. If you have extra time while you're in the area, you might want to stop by Dennis Martinez National Stadium and Managua Cathedral.
